Medical Cabinet

Description
A mod that adds a two wall mounted medical cabinets, one powered and thermally regulated and the other a simple box.

Powered Medical Cabinet:

Power consumption - Default: 15W
Maximum stack size - Default: 1
Steel required for crafting: 40
Components required for crafting: 1

Simple Medical Cabinet:

Maximum stack size - Default: 1
Steel required for crafting: 20

Both can be configured in the mod options.

Known Issue:
Placing the cabinet above a shelf or other storage item may trigger an error indicating conflicting storage. This behavior can result in the shelf's contents being redirected to the medical cabinet, likely due to overlapping storage zones occupying the same cell.

it is recommended to avoid placing these cabinets directly above other storage objects. Placement elsewhere should function as intended.

it appears that the <isEdifice>false</isEdifice> property is causing the items to deteriorate outdoors.

Deadbeat  [author] 26 Jul @ 12:13pm 
@King do you mean in furniture or do you mean in the storage tab you get from neatstorage?

That storage tab is custom to neatstorage and if I push it into there I would then require people to use that mod also.

But you could do this edit yourself also. Open this mod go into Defs\ThingDefs_Buildings and open the xml file inside.

Replace:
<designationCategory Inherit="false">Furniture</designationCategory>
<designationCategory Inherit="false">Temperature</designationCategory>

Replace both the above lines with:

<designationCategory Inherit="false">BuildingsNeatStorage</designationCategory>
